Cougars Dominate Wyoming Valley Conference Swimming Opener
The Hazleton Area Cougars delivered a commanding performance in their Wyoming Valley Conference swimming opener, defeating the Wyoming Area Warriors with a score of 94-82. The meet, held on March 15, 2024, showcased the talents of several standout swimmers from Hazleton, particularly on the girls’ team.
Lorelei Lucas, Lia Ochs, and Mariannyi Brache-Minaya each secured two individual victories in the competition. Lucas excelled in the 200-yard freestyle and the 100 butterfly, while Ochs dominated the 200 individual medley and the 500 freestyle. Brache-Minaya triumphed in both the 50 freestyle and the 100 breaststroke. In addition to individual successes, the Cougars also claimed victory in all three relay events, with Lucas, Ochs, and Brache-Minaya contributing to those wins.
The performance of the Hazleton Area boys’ team was equally impressive, as they overpowered the Warriors with a score of 125-27. Double winners for the Cougars included Chase Kaschak, who excelled in the 200 freestyle and 100 butterfly, and Cason Machey, who won both the 200 individual medley and the 100 backstroke. Teammates Cody Scholl and Wellington Reyes also contributed with victories in the 500 freestyle and 100 breaststroke, respectively. The boys’ team, like the girls, swept the relay events.
Schuylkill League Highlights
In other swimming action, the Schuylkill League featured several noteworthy performances. The Schuylkill Haven boys’ team triumphed over Mahanoy Area with a decisive score of 106-13. Ethan Miller set a new record for the Haven in the 100-yard butterfly, marking a significant achievement for the team. The only victory for Mahanoy Area was secured by Blake Brown, who won the 1-backstroke.
The North Schuylkill boys’ team also had a successful meet, defeating Shamokin with a score of 105-46. Standout performances came from Brendan Fetterolf, who won both the 200 freestyle and 100 breaststroke, David Luna, who took first in the 200 individual medley and 500 freestyle, and Owen Mentzer, who excelled in the 50 freestyle and 100 backstroke. Teammate Fabrizio Mangianello also finished first in the 100 freestyle.
Girls’ Events in Schuylkill League
In the girls’ events, Schuylkill Haven defeated Mahanoy Area with a score of 80-49. Lily Brown took both the 200 individual medley and 100 breaststroke, leading the Lady Bears to victory. Additional wins came from Kendall Kardisco in the 100 butterfly and McKenzie Scully in the 100 backstroke, while Cali Stauffer excelled for Haven, winning both sprint races.
North Schuylkill’s girls’ team achieved a convincing win over Shamokin, finishing with a score of 96-21. The Lady Spartans were led by Keira Blozousky, who won both the 200 freestyle and 100 butterfly, and Katelyn Nahodil, who claimed victories in the 200 individual medley and 500 freestyle. Kamryn Wolfe also had a strong showing, winning both the 50 freestyle and 100 backstroke. Additional first-place finishes were registered by Annabelle Bennett in diving and Elizabeth Nahodil in the 100 breaststroke.
